Well I just got back from the range, I am not the type who needs time to warm up to clubs it feels good or it doesn't, and my first impression is real good. These feel very solid at impact, and unlike my mp-001 the face on the gauge feels hotter, the miz. feel is a little dead to me. I had these shafted with nippon 950, and these are just like shooting pellets, for me this combo really works. While I hit the miz. vey well it's just not the same the ball seems to jump off the face, and I found it easier off the tee than the v steel. So for me it I won't be looking for a fw for a while, I know I have said this before, but now I mean it.
